Apparatuses for Antegrade Transcatheter Valve Repair or Implantation
Summary
The USPTO has published patent application US20260108351A1, filed January 8, 2024, covering medical devices and systems for performing valve replacement or repair. The disclosed inventions include an outer catheter with one or more interchangeable inner catheters, a guidewire, and an expandable chordae tendinae deflector. The inner catheter may include a chordae tendinae deflector, and the outer catheter may be configured as a rapid pacing sheath. Named inventors are Tim A. FISCHELL and Frank SALTIEL. CPC classification is A61F 2/243.
